Shift lead: the Corvid-9 cooler leaves tonight for the Meridell field clinic. Contents are temperature-sensitive and must remain between 2°C and 8°C; the data logger inside records the full journey and must not be switched off. Pre-chill the spare gel packs and swap them at load time, not before. Check the lid latches twice and verify the tamper strip is unbroken. Total hold time outside refrigeration must not exceed twenty minutes. The confidential courier hand-over instruction follows immediately below.

courier memo of yahif-faweg: the quenael tamius courier leaves the prawyn jorix kaswyn istox silmir brieth zormir fenvan ledger at gate 3145 under passcode 231062

14:02 — Duplicate charges detected on Pinwheel Pay retries. Root cause: idempotency keys were derived from request timestamps, so client retries after gateway timeouts minted fresh keys. 14:19 — Retry storm from the Oakhollow checkout service amplified duplicates. 14:31 — Hotfix switched key derivation to the order UUID; dedupe cache flushed. 14:55 — Reconciliation job queued refunds for 312 affected orders. No customer escalations yet. Full dedupe audit runs tonight. The hotfix deployment is traceable via the token below.

pipeline stamp: htk9_ce63042d9

TICKET-1177: Documenting for future maintainers. The nightly cron-drift investigation on Tidemill stalled because the collector's credential quietly expired, so drift graphs show a flat line from the 4th onward — not actual stability. We rotated the credential and backfilled three days of samples. If the graph flatlines again, check expiry before anything else. The rotated collector key is below.

API key for fahif-bahop: vxb23-B1zKyQaAnaG4Gma9WuizPfB

Step 4: Deploying the Givenote receipt mailer.

Before promoting the build, confirm the staging run generated at least one test receipt and that the template checksum matches the release manifest. Drain the outbound mail queue first — in-flight receipts must not be duplicated during cutover. Then apply the new configuration to the Harbright workers one at a time, watching bounce rates between each. The final promotion command requires the artifact to be signed, so have the key ready. The active deploy key is shown below.

rollout seal: bky4_x7Gc